ROMFORD ENTERTAINMENT AND EVENTS
Artists from Romford Contemporary Arts Programme will be taking over a shop in Quadrant Arcade in April. For more on artists working in Romford please see http://www.romfordarts.com. There will be a “Market Apprentice Day” in Romford Market on 25th May to celebrate the “Love your local market” campaign. The Liberty Shopping Centre will be holding a fashion design competition on 31st May 11am-1.30pm, and a fashion show weekend on 1st and 2nd June from 11am-5pm. For more information please see http://www.theliberty.co.uk. On 11th June Havering 90 Joggers will be holding their annual 5 mile run around Raphael Park and local roads, admission is £5 affiliated clubs, £7 for non-affiliated. For more information please see www.h90j.org.uk. On Saturday 22nd June Havering Concert Orchestra will be performing works by George Gershwin, Beethoven and others at Frances Bardsley School. For more information please see http://www.hcoweb.co.uk or phone 0208 220 5147. Romford Summer Theatre will be performing “A Comedy of Errors” in Raphael Park on 20-23rd June and 27-29th June, for more information please see http://www.romfordsummertheatre.com. On Saturday 29th June there will be a parade through Romford town centre to mark Armed Forces Day. On 4th July there will be a campaign to promote independent retailers in Romford as part of “Independents Day”. There will be a performance of “Noah’s Flood” at St. Edward’s C. of E. Church in the Market this summer - for more information please see posters outside the church. On 28th July Friends of Cottons Park will hold their annual Fun Day, for more information please see http://www.friendsofcottonspark.webden.co.uk. There will be Italian Markets on 7th July and 8th September. There will be “Twilight market” events involving traders in September to encourage commuters into the town centre.
